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ma lawyers are able to file personal injury and wrongful-death lawsuits against asbestos-related businesses. They can assist you in recovering substantial damages in the form of money.

Compensation can cover future and past medical expenses, suffering and pain, lost income, and funeral costs. Top asbestos law firms offer extensive resources from the industry with compassionate service to ensure you get the best possible compensation.

Compensation for mesothelioma as well as other asbestos-related illnesses can help patients family members and caregivers deal with medical expenses and other expenses related to the disease. Compensation also can help victims recoup lost income.

A mesothelioma attorney can help victims identify asbestos companies that are responsible and may be responsible for damages. Attorneys can bring lawsuits to recover legal fees and costs related to the case.

Asbestos lawyers can also examine trust funds to determine if the victims could be eligible for further compensation. These trust funds were set up by asbestos manufacturers, who knew that their products were dangerous, but continued to sell asbestos in order to make profits. These trusts have paid thousands of victims.

Mesothelioma lawsuits have recouped significant sums of money for victims and their loved ones. Compensation can be used to pay for a range of expenses that include medical bills as well as travel expenses and lost wages.

The best mesothelioma lawyers have a presence across the country and are knowledgeable of state laws and court rulings that affect asbestos litigation. Mesothelioma firms typically work on a contingency basis, which means that clients do not pay upfront. They only get paid by the amount they collect for their clients. This is a great opportunity asbestos victims to receive the legal assistance they need without worrying about the cost.

It is important to hire an attorney for mesothelioma immediately, as the time limit for filing claims will vary from state to state. A national firm will know how to file a claim in every state and assist veterans in filing VA benefits too.

The majority of mesothelioma cases don't go to trial and instead are resolved through an agreement. This means that patients can receive compensation much faster than if a trial were held. The average mesothelioma settlement is around $1 million, but it can be higher depending on the circumstances of the case.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should be able explain the benefits of settlements, and how they compare to other options such as trial. They will also ensure that the statute of limitations is not missed, since mistakes can lead to the victims and their families being denied the amount of compensation.

Asbestos victims should select mesothelioma laws that have national offices and is familiar with asbestos trust funds. Many asbestos victims were exposed to asbestos in several states. A national firm can bring a case in the best place to maximize the amount of compensation that is paid.

A mesothelioma lawyer will handle the entire claim from beginning to end. This includes filing the lawsuit, conducting an investigation depositions, making depositions, arguing in a trial before a jury and reaching a settlement.
